Understanding and Maintaining Driveshaft Support Bearings for Reliable Vehicle Performance

Driveshaft support bearings play a crucial role in the smooth and efficient operation of vehicles by supporting the driveshaft and reducing vibrations. Neglecting their maintenance can lead to costly repairs and even safety hazards. This comprehensive guide delves into the significance, functions, and proper maintenance practices of driveshaft support bearings, providing valuable information for vehicle owners and technicians alike.

Significance of Driveshaft Support Bearings

Driveshaft support bearings are critical components that ensure the following:

  • Smooth Power Transmission: They support the driveshaft, allowing it to rotate freely and transmit power from the transmission to the wheels without excessive vibrations.
  • Reduced Noise and Harshness: By absorbing vibrations, support bearings minimize noise and improve overall driving comfort.
  • Extended Driveshaft Life: Adequate support reduces wear and tear on the driveshaft, extending its lifespan and reducing maintenance costs.
  • Improved Fuel Efficiency: Reduced vibrations minimize energy loss, leading to improved fuel economy.
  • Safety: Faulty support bearings can cause excessive vibrations, which can lead to instability, brake failure, and other safety concerns.

Functions of Driveshaft Support Bearings

Driveshaft support bearings primarily perform the following functions:

  • Support: They provide support to the driveshaft, preventing it from sagging or bending under load.
  • Vibration Isolation: They absorb vibrations generated by the driveshaft due to imbalances, harmonics, or road conditions.
  • Alignment: Support bearings help maintain proper alignment of the driveshaft, reducing stress on other components.
  • Lubrication: They facilitate lubrication of the driveshaft, ensuring smooth rotation and reduced friction.

How to Replace a Driveshaft Support Bearing

Replacing a driveshaft support bearing requires specialized tools and knowledge. It is recommended to consult a qualified mechanic for this task. However, if you are confident in your mechanical abilities, follow these steps:

  1. Safety First: Engage the parking brake and use jack stands or ramps for safety before working under the vehicle.
  2. Locate the Bearing: Identify the driveshaft support bearing that needs replacement. It is typically located near the center of the driveshaft.
  3. Remove the Driveshaft: Disconnect the driveshaft from the transmission and differential. Remove the driveshaft from the vehicle.
  4. Unbolt the Old Bearing: Locate the bolts that hold the support bearing in place. Carefully unbolt the bolts and remove the old bearing.
  5. Install the New Bearing: Insert the new support bearing into place and secure it with the bolts. Tighten the bolts to the specified torque.
  6. Reinstall the Driveshaft: Reinstall the driveshaft into the vehicle and connect it to the transmission and differential.
  7. Test Drive: Take the vehicle for a test drive to ensure that the support bearing is functioning properly and that there are no abnormal noises or vibrations.

  2. What are the signs of a failing driveshaft support bearing?
    - Listen for unusual noises, such as clunking or rattling, coming from underneath the vehicle.
    - Check for excessive vibrations during acceleration or deceleration.
    - Observe any uneven wear or oil leaks around the support bearing.
